EVALUATING PRECISION OF PLUVIAL FLOODING ANALYSIS AFFECTED BY DIFFERENCE INTERVAL OF RAINFALL EVENTS

Abstract
In recent years, damage caused by heavy rainfall for short period has been increasing in urban areas. In 2013 in Osaka, heavy rainfall—67mm per one hour and 27.5mm in 10 minutes—led to inundation above and below floor level and road inundation, which caused traffic disturbances. We focused on the center of Osaka, which has a large underground mall. Using 1D-2D urban flood analysis model, we predicted the overflow amount of pluvial floodwater, the expanse area and the onset of discharge, clarified the behavior of rainwater in the sewer system for five rainfall events. It is important that engineers should consider the adequate difference interval of rainfall events in analysis.
